PAC convenes meeting to discuss Ncell



KATHMANDU: The House of Representatives’ Public Accounts Committee (PAC) has convened a session to delve into the intricacies of the Ncell share transactions.

Savitra Sharma, a official at the Committee, confirmed the meeting’s purpose, primarily aimed at initiating discussions on the buying and selling of shares within the Telecommunication Service Provider Organization, Ncell.

Scheduled for Wednesday at 2 pm in the committee’s Singha Durbar meeting room, the gathering will center around deliberations regarding Ncell’s operations.

Last Friday, Malaysian company Axiata declared the sale of 80 percent of its Ncell shares to UK’s Spectralite Limited for 50 million US dollars (6.66 billion rupees).
